Maximizing Your Chase Sapphire Travel Rewards
To truly unlock the complete potential of your Chase Sapphire Select travel rewards, a strategic plan is vital. Don’t just apply your points casually; think about these crucial strategies. First, regularly transfer your Ultimate Rewards points to copyright partners like United or Hyatt – often yielding a substantial return higher than redeeming them for travel directly through Chase the website. Moreover, take benefit of the boosted point worth when booking accommodations through the Chase booking portal. Finally, don’t forget to track your membership and consider advantage of any limited offers or sales that appear available.
